Women's Soccer Unable to Overcome Slow Start

Box Score

FOND DU LAC, Wis. – The Marian University women's soccer team was unable to bounce back from a slow start and MSOE topped the Sabres 3-0 Monday afternoon in Northern Athletics Collegiate Conference action at Smith Field.

Sara Travia scored on a breakaway three minutes into the first half and the Raiders (12-3-1, 7-0-0 NACC) went into halftime with a narrow 1-0 advantage.

MSOE added two goals late in the second half to close out the contest.

After allowing the opening goal the Sabres (4-9-0, 2-5-0 NACC) nearly tied it moments later when Carley Schmit sailed it wide.

Nicole Wojahn added two shots and Molly Kovarik, Jenna Wojahn and Alexis Peterson each recorded a shot attempt.

The Sabres return to the pitch Wednesday at Concordia Wisconsin.
